Route details: Bogotá to Villa de Leyva

Travel time

3 h 30 min

Distance

165 km

Typical fare

$7 – $12 USD per person

Frequency

Multiple daily buses + Saturday morning rush

First departure

Approx. 5:00 AM

Last departure

Approx. 5:00 PM

Operators on this route

Libertadores · Concorde · Local buses

Pickup at Bogotá

Terminal del Norte in Bogotá (Salitre, accessible by TransMilenio)

Drop-off at Villa de Leyva

Villa de Leyva central bus terminal — ~5 min walk to Plaza Mayor + colonial center hotels

About the journey

The Bogotá → Villa de Leyva route is Colombia's most-popular colonial weekend escape from Bogotá — ~3-4 hours northeast via Tunja. Multiple daily buses from Terminal del Norte with a Saturday morning rush for weekend escapes. The route climbs through the Andean Cundinamarca + Boyacá countryside.

Travel tips for BogotáVilla de Leyva

  • Saturday morning rush from Bogotá — book ahead for weekend escapes.
  • Best mid-week to avoid Bogotá weekend crowds — Saturdays + Sundays the town fills with weekenders.
  • Plaza Mayor at evening for atmospheric light + spectacular colonial visual.
  • Museo El Fósil with famous Kronosaurus boyacensis plesiosaur (~5 km from town).
  • Pozos Azules turquoise pools (~10 km).
  • Cool mountain climate at 2,140 m altitude — bring layers.
  • Stay 1-2 nights for proper experience.

Frequently asked questions

How long is the bus from Bogotá to Villa de Leyva?

**About 3-4 hours** on Libertadores / Concorde / local buses via Tunja.

How much is the bus from Bogotá to Villa de Leyva?

**COP 30,000-50,000 / US$7-12 per person**.

Why is Villa de Leyva famous?

**Colombia's largest cobblestone colonial plaza** (Plaza Mayor ~14,000 m²) + beautifully preserved 16th-century colonial architecture (national monument since 1954). Founded 1572. Surrounding Boyacá department famous for Cretaceous fossil sites (Kronosaurus boyacensis plesiosaur at Museo El Fósil).

What time do buses leave Bogotá for Villa de Leyva?

**Multiple daily — typically 5 AM, 7 AM, 9 AM, 11 AM, 1 PM, 3 PM, 5 PM** from Terminal del Norte. Saturday morning rush for weekend escapes.

Should I visit on a weekend or weekday?

**Weekdays for quieter experience.** Bogotá residents fill the town Saturdays + Sundays. Weekend has more restaurants/shops open + lively atmosphere; weekdays more atmospheric + quiet.
